Your Sydney Neighbor Just Won $100 Million and Doesn’t Know It Yet

Someone in Sydney’s Eastern Suburbs just became $100 million richer without even knowing it yet. The massive Powerball jackpot winner from draw 1517 on June 12, 2025, has created headlines across Australia as lottery officials desperately search for the mystery multi-millionaire.

This incredible win represents the biggest jackpot of 2025 and places the lucky ticket holder among Australia’s most exclusive group of lottery winners. Only six other Australians have ever claimed a $100 million Powerball prize, making this win truly extraordinary.

The Winning Numbers That Changed Everything

The life-changing numbers drawn on Thursday night were 28, 10, 3, 16, 31, 14, and 21, with the crucial Powerball number 6. These seven numbers have created Australia’s newest multi-millionaire, but the winner might still be completely unaware of their incredible fortune.

Matt Hart from The Lott expressed excitement about finding the winner: “There are 100 million reasons why all Sydney players who had an entry in this week’s draw should check their ticket as soon as possible.” The winning ticket was purchased from an outlet in Sydney’s Eastern Suburbs, but remains unregistered.

Breaking Records in Australian Lottery History

This $100 million Powerball jackpot represents only the seventh time an Australian player has secured such a massive prize. The winner now shares the prestigious title of Australia’s third-largest lottery winner with other fortunate individuals who have claimed nine-figure prizes.

New South Wales continues to dominate lottery wins, with the state recording 11 Powerball division one entries in 2024 alone. Queensland followed with six wins, while Victoria managed two, and South Australia and Western Australia each secured one major jackpot.

The Dark Side of Lottery Success

While most winners handle their newfound wealth responsibly, recent tragic news highlights potential dangers. Joshua Winslet, a 22-year-old plumber who won $22 million in 2019, sadly passed away after struggling with substance abuse following his lottery success. His story serves as a sobering reminder that sudden wealth requires careful management.

Financial experts consistently recommend winners seek professional advice immediately. Proper planning and support systems can help ensure lottery success remains a blessing rather than becoming overwhelming.

Previous Australian Lottery Legends

Australia’s biggest individual lottery winner remains a South Australian man who claimed $150 million in May 2024. Before him, a New South Wales couple and Queensland woman shared a record-breaking $200 million prize in February 2024, each receiving $100 million.

The Mathematics of Massive Wins

The odds of winning Powerball’s division one prize stand at approximately 134 million to one. These astronomical odds make every jackpot winner extraordinarily fortunate and explain why such prizes generate massive public interest.
